500+ Semi-Detached for Sale in Carstairs , AB

500+ Carstairs semi-detached for sale | Book a showing for affordable semi-detached in Carstairs with pools, walkouts. Prices from $1 to $5M. Open houses available.

Explore Homes for Sale Nearby Carstairs